Output 21d74160a4001cf8129cad619ad1b4cce2eb9d7c0a0d6528e37ddfb0508b5142:1

value
1018800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dbaf0ad5b097513b396719e7ae4944eaed6b386 OP_EQUAL
address
3JzDadRCjqa158mjpo3u4pYUTveqE6VBMC
transaction
21d74160a4001cf8129cad619ad1b4cce2eb9d7c0a0d6528e37ddfb0508b5142
spent
true